This model shows a concrete cooling tower, which incorporates typical structural features of vertical engineering structures. Cooling towers are crucial for industrial process applications, as they efficiently dissipate excess heat into the atmosphere. Such structures require precise geometric and material design to ensure stability and resistance to weather conditions. The model is an ideal example of the use of reinforced concrete in building construction to realize complex structural solutions.
